Chapter 353 What a Coincidence (The Fourth Day of the Lunar New Year! I wish everyone a bright future!)

At the Mao hour, the sky was still pitch - black. Most families were still in slumber. At the palace gate, the energetic Su Qing showed his waist token to the guards and then strode into the palace.

After the battle at Yandang Mountain, Su Qing not only got the job of commanding the Jingji Army but also received a waist token that allowed him to enter and leave the palace at will. Today, this token finally came in handy.

Following the little eunuch step by step towards the imperial study, Su Qing straightened his clothes, trying to look more rushed.

Before long, they arrived at the imperial study.

The little eunuch said respectfully, "Your Majesty has not gotten up yet. Please wait here for a while, Duke Yong."

With a wave of his big hand, Su Qing said, "It's okay. Go ahead, little eunuch. I've got plenty of time."

However, Su Qing had only stood there for a short while when he heard another sound of footsteps behind him. He could tell at once that someone was coming this way. Su Qing quickly put on an extremely aggrieved look, turned around, and bowed towards the source of the sound.

"Your Majesty—"

When he saw the face of the person coming, the next words got stuck in his throat.

"Lord Zhang, why is it you?" Su Qing said with a gloomy face.

The person coming was Zhang Wentao, the Minister of the Ministry of Punishment. Seeing him, the other person was also very surprised. "Duke Yong, you're here too?"

Su Qing smiled subtly and asked, "What brings you here, Lord Zhang?"

Zhang Wentao said with a straight face, "I just have some government affairs to report to His Majesty."

Then, the two stood side by side outside the imperial study, but neither of them showed any intention of talking to the other.

Before a cup of tea had passed, there came another sound of footsteps from the way they had come.

The two of them turned around in unison and bowed towards that direction. "Your Majesty—"

Hearing the equally aggrieved tone beside him, Su Qing couldn't help but glance at Zhang Wentao next to him, secretly thinking that this Minister of the Ministry of Punishment was quite good at pretending.

But when the person showed up, both of them had the same constipated expressions on their faces. Zhang Wentao forced a smile. "Lord Qin, what a coincidence. You're here to see His Majesty too?"

Yes, the person coming was Qin Xiao, the Minister of the Court of Judicature, and also the biological father of Qin Wanrong.

Qin Xiao was very thin but quite tall, almost as tall as Su Qing, who had been riding horses and practicing martial arts all year round. Seeing that both Su Qing and Zhang Wentao were there, he seemed not surprised at all. He nodded to them, then tucked in his sleeves and stood beside Zhang Wentao with his eyes closed.

Su Qing remembered what Mrs. Mo had told him. At the Qin - appreciation banquet, the daughters of the Ministry of Punishment, the Court of Judicature, and the Censorate had all stood on the side of his daughter Yuanbao. He vaguely guessed something. His eyes swept across the faces of Zhang Wentao and Qin Xiao, and Su Qing grinned.

Great. It seemed he wasn't fighting alone.

Since the people from the Ministry of Punishment and the Court of Judicature were both here, wasn't it about time for the Censorate to show up?

Sure enough, not long after, Zhuo Hong, the Chief Censor of the Censorate, also appeared at the end of the path and walked towards them.

The actual power - holders of the Three Judicial Offices, plus Duke Yong Su Qing. Well, now everyone was here. Su Qing couldn't help but wonder how the emperor would deal with them later.

He felt a little bit of anticipation for no reason.

...

There was no court session today, so the emperor got up a bit later than usual. He lived alone in the Chengan Palace and didn't ask any concubines to accompany him. After waking up, he changed into his regular clothes under the service of the palace servants, had a simple breakfast, and then took the sedan chair towards the imperial study to deal with government affairs.

The emperor sat in the sedan chair with his eyes closed, resting. As they were walking, he suddenly heard a series of crying sounds coming from the front.

"Your Majesty! Your Majesty, please do justice for me!"

"Your Majesty, I'm so aggrieved!"

These cries reminded the emperor of the ministers who had cried outside his door, begging him to take back his order after Yan Huan was dismissed from office. His eyebrows frowned involuntarily.

Again?

The sedan chair stopped accordingly. The emperor opened his eyes and saw four figures kneeling outside the imperial study, crying with snot and tears, as if they had suffered some great injustice.

All of these four figures were usually seen as majestic, upright, and serious in the eyes of others. But now they were crying like women, which really made the emperor feel a chill down his back.

It was okay for Su Qing, but why were the people from the Three Judicial Offices following his example?

Eunuch Bao was about to step forward to stop them, but the emperor stopped him, indicating that he wanted to hear what these people were crying about.

"Your Majesty, my son and I have been dedicated to the Great Chu whole - heartedly and never dared to slack off even a bit. But now we're being treated like this. I'm so heart - broken! Wuwuwu..." It was obviously Su Qing.

"My beloved daughter lost her mother at birth. She was born weak and has been sickly. The imperial doctor said she wouldn't live past seventeen. Yesterday, she finally had the energy to go out for a walk, but she suffered such injustice. After she got home, she fell ill again. I'm so heart - stricken!" This was Qin Xiao, the Minister of the Court of Judicature.

And from the Censorate: "As the Chief Censor of the Censorate, I've always enforced the law impartially. But I never thought I'd be framed as a traitor. I can no longer be the Chief Censor. I beg Your Majesty to allow me to retire and return to my hometown."

Minister Zhang: "..." These people had said everything. What could he say?

So, his cry was the loudest. "Your Majesty, please do justice for us!"

But the emperor knew these people were crying deliberately for him. After all, with Su Qing's martial arts skills, how could he not hear the movement behind him?

Having a clear idea in mind, the emperor gave a look to the eunuch beside him. The eunuch immediately announced, "His Majesty is coming—"

Only then did these people seem to wake up suddenly. They turned around and looked behind them.

Meeting the emperor's eyes in the sedan chair, Su Qing immediately knelt in another direction and cried to the emperor, "Your Majesty, please do justice for me!"

The other three also knelt down and said the same words as Su Qing.

The sedan chair stopped. The emperor got out and walked up to the four people. Looking down, he asked, "You all came into the palace early in the morning and cried so sadly outside my imperial study. What kind of difficult thing have you encountered?"

Su Qing felt that the emperor's tone didn't sound very happy. He secretly cursed his bad luck. He had come to the palace to seek an explanation today but had run into the emperor in a bad mood.

Pretending to wipe away the non - existent tears from the corner of his eyes, Su Qing said,

"This matter, well, it's quite complicated. It can't be explained clearly to Your Majesty in a short time."

Zhang Wentao said, "Yes. This matter involves the imperial heir. Please move to the imperial study, Your Majesty. We'll explain it to you in detail."

"Oh, really?" The emperor's eyes swept across the faces of these people. Suddenly, he laughed and said, "Then come in with me. I'd like to hear who on earth dares to bully the once - famous General who Pacified the Borders and the heads of the Three Judicial Offices, making you so aggrieved and angry that you even came into the palace to see me."

After saying that, the emperor walked towards the imperial study with his hands behind his back. Seeing this, Su Qing, Zhang Wentao, and the others quickly got up and followed him in.
